Harley Quinn Calls Out Joseph Linsner For Going Off Script

The last time I remember this happening was in Deadpool. When the artist drew a big figure of Deadpool wrapped around the rest of the art without, it seems, being in the script. So, because it was Deadpool, the writer Christopher Priest, rewrote the script to have Deadpool talking about the writer having to rewrite the script to accommodate the artists'whims.

It must happen all the time. It's just not often the lead character is asked to comment on it.

Like in today's Harley Quinn. Where the artist Joseph Michael Linsner, it seems, went a little tree happy. And Jimmy Palmiotti and Amanda Conner weren't going to let him get away with it.
